She cannot get Muhammad Najem, a 19-year-old who bravely exposed the Syrian regime’s atrocities in Eastern Ghouta, out of her mind. Following the tragic loss of his father in an airstrike, Muhammad and his brother would film the devastation caused by daily bombings from their rooftop to shed light on the suffering of survivors. Muhammad and his family eventually became targets of the government and sought refuge in Turkey, where he shared his harrowing story. What stood out about Muhammad was not just his courage, but also his infectious smile and zest for life despite witnessing unimaginable horrors. Angelina Jolie has been a dedicated advocate for human rights for two decades, starting as a goodwill ambassador and later serving as a special envoy for the UN high commissioner for refugees. Through over 60 field missions to countries like Syria, Sierra Leone, Iraq, and Afghanistan, she has witnessed firsthand the struggles of people displaced by conflict and persecution.

Now, at the age of 46, Jolie has collaborated with child rights lawyer Geraldine Van Bueren QC and Amnesty International to create a book titled “Know Your Rights”. This guide for young people, inspired by the Clash song that is tattooed on Jolie’s back, outlines all the rights children are entitled to under the UN convention on the rights of the child. With input from young individuals who have successfully claimed their rights, the book provides valuable advice on how to navigate the system.

“Know Your Rights” covers a range of important topics in a conversational and easy-to-understand manner. From the right to life, dignity, and health, to issues of equality, non-discrimination, and freedom of expression, the book empowers young readers to understand and assert their rights. It also addresses the right to a safe environment, access to education, and protection from harm and violence.
